What Is Udyog Aadhaar?

Udyog Aadhaar was a government registration system designed specifically for MSMEs. It provided businesses with a unique identification number, enabling them to formally exist within India’s regulatory and financial ecosystem without facing heavy bureaucratic hurdles.

The initiative was launched by the Government of India to reduce red tape and encourage entrepreneurship, particularly among small-scale enterprises.


Why Was Udyog Aadhaar Introduced?

Before its introduction, registering a small business often required extensive paperwork, multiple approvals, and long waiting periods. Udyog Aadhaar aimed to solve several challenges:

  • Eliminate complex registration processes

  • Promote ease of doing business

  • Improve access to credit and subsidies

  • Create a unified MSME database

The program was administered by the Ministry of Micro, Small and Medium Enterprises, reflecting a broader policy shift toward digitization and simplification.


Key Benefits for Businesses

Registering under Udyog Aadhaar offered multiple practical advantages:

1. Simplified Registration

Entrepreneurs could complete registration online with minimal documentation, reducing compliance friction.

2. Access to Government Schemes

Registered businesses became eligible for numerous MSME-specific programs, including:

  • Credit guarantee schemes

  • Subsidies on patents and barcodes

  • Financial support for technology upgrades

3. Easier Bank Loans

Financial institutions often view registered MSMEs as lower-risk borrowers, which can improve loan approval chances.

4. Protection Against Delayed Payments

Certain MSME protections help businesses recover dues from buyers more efficiently.


Who Could Apply?

Udyog Aadhaar primarily targeted:

  • Micro enterprises

  • Small enterprises

  • Medium enterprises

This included manufacturers, service providers, traders, startups, and even individual proprietors.


The Transition to Udyam Registration

It is important to note that Udyog Aadhaar has since been replaced by Udyam Registration, which further refines MSME classification and compliance structures. However, the core objective remains the same: simplifying business formalization and improving institutional access.

Businesses previously registered under Udyog Aadhaar are encouraged to migrate to the newer system.
